Duties Description

  • Provide supports and services.
  • Advocate, encourage, guide and teach individuals in expressing personal choice.
  • Ensure community integration.
  • Assist individuals with personal hygiene care, toileting, dining, dressing, meal preparation, lifts and transfers.
  • Help individuals to participate in games and recreational programs.
  • Coach and encourage individuals to develop daily living skills.
  • Provide a clean, safe, and comfortable environment.
  • Work with other staff to carry out care plans and to record care plans.
  • Administer medication in accordance with special instructions.

Minimum Qualifications
  • You must have a high school diploma or an equivalency, such as a GED or a Direct Support Professional (DSP) Certificate from an accredited public or private organization.
  • You must have a valid license to operate a motor vehicle in New York State. You will be required to maintain a valid driver's license throughout your employment as a DSA.
  • You must meet physical and agility standards.
Additional Comments
  • This title is part of the New York Hiring for Emergency Limited Placement Statewide Program (NY HELPS). HELPS Program titles may be filled via a non-competitive appointment. This means that you do not need to take an exam to qualify, but you do need to meet the minimum qualifications of the title.
  • At a future date (within one year of permanent appointment), employees hired under NY HELPS are expected to have their permanent non-competitive employment status converted to permanent competitive status. You will not have to take an exam to gain permanent competitive status.
  • Please note that starting salary for this title reflects the increased hiring salary and geographic pay differential. Posted Hiring Salary includes the sum of the statutory hiring rate for CSEA Grade 9 ($42,641), Increased Hiring Salary ($5,584) and Geographic Pay Differential ($4,000). Geographic Pay Differential added to the job rate ($52,413).
